3D Printing Photopolymer Market Trends and Forecast
The future of the global 3D printing photopolymer market looks promising with opportunities in the aerospace & defense, healthcare, and automotive end use industries. The global 3D printing photopolymer market is expected to reach an estimated $0.97 billion by 2028 with a CAGR of 16.1% from 2023 to 2028. The major drivers for this market are growing adoption of 3D printing in additive manufacturing, ongoing technological advancement in printing technologies, and increasing inclination towards photopolymer owing to its cost effectiveness over metals.

3D Printing Photopolymer Market Insights
-
Lucintel forecasts that stereolithography (SLA) will remain the largest technology segment over the forecast period due to its reliability and preciseness and its increasing acceptance across various end use industries.
-
Within this market, healthcare will remain the largest end use industry segment over the forecast period due to its increasing application in developing personalized medical solutions, print implants, prosthetics, devices for tissue engineering, and many other medical solutions.
-
North America will remain the largest region during the forecast period due to increasing acceptance of IoT and technological advancements and the presence of major players in the region.
